What is it about?

a study focus on determining the best locations for dry ports in the Surabaya and Teluk Lamong areas. It involves using a combination of Multi-Criteria Decision Making (MCDM) techniques and the Uncapacitated Fixed Charge Location Problem model. MCDM helps evaluate and rank different location options based on multiple criteria, while the Uncapacitated Fixed Charge Location Problem model addresses the logistical and cost aspects of site selection. The goal is to identify optimal dry port locations that enhance efficiency and reduce costs for container terminal operations.
